Question

A and B can complete a job together in $12.5$ days. B and C can complete the same job together in $18.75$ days, while C and A can complete the same job together in $15$ days. In how many days will A, B, and C together be able to complete the same job alongside D, who is only 40%40% as efficient as C?

Options

A.

9 \frac{1}{3}

B.

9 \frac{2}{3}

C.

9 \frac{7}{27}

D.

9 \frac{17}{27}
